    How much does a Condominium Management make?

    As of Aug 3, 2026, the average annual pay for a Condominium Management in the United States is $61,549 a year.

    Just in case you need a simple salary calculator, that works out to be approximately $29.59 an hour. This is the equivalent of $1,183/week or $5,129/month.

    While ZipRecruiter is seeing annual salaries as high as $117,500 and as low as $20,500, the majority of Condominium Management salaries currently range between $35,000 (25th percentile) to $80,000 (75th percentile) with top earners (90th percentile) making $98,500 annually across the United States. The average pay range for a Condominium Management varies greatly (by as much as 45000), which suggests there may be many opportunities for advancement and increased pay based on skill level, location and years of experience.

    A Condominium Management in your area makes on average $59,451 per year, or $2,098 (3.409%) less than the national average annual salary of $61,549. Ohio ranks number 30 out of 50 states nationwide for Condominium Management salaries.
